Internal Memo — Expansion into the Caldren Region

To the board: Northway Provisions will open its first Caldren distribution hub in the second quarter, following favourable lease terms in Brindmoor. Initial staffing is forty roles, with logistics handled by our existing Velport fleet. Capital outlay remains within the approved envelope. The confidential element of the plan is set out below.

management briefing: Project Ulavan slips by two quarters because of the staffing delay.

TICKET-4417: Matchline deploy blocked — signature check failed on build 2.9.1. Root cause suspected: artifact re-signed mid-pipeline while we were profiling GC pauses in the matching service (p99 pauses hit 1.4s under load, separate thread). Rollback to 2.9.0 clean. Fix: pin the signer step before the GC instrumentation stage. Owner: Dray. ETA Thursday. For verification at the sync, the current artifact signing key is below.

signing key of bagap-yawep = bky13_TbfT6ZMUoGJo2

## Approvals — SpinSafe Locker Access Flow

Any change to the SpinSafe laundry-locker access flow requires a recorded approval before it enters a release train. This covers PIN entry, courier unlock codes, and the emergency-release path. The release manager should verify that the approval ticket is linked in the release checklist and that staging runs of the full unlock cycle have passed. Partial approvals are not accepted; the flow is treated as a single unit. The designated approver for all access-flow changes is named below.

named custodian: Brivan Eliath Quenox Frador

FD Leak Hunt — Grifflet Gateway

If fd count on a grifflet pod climbs past 80% of ulimit, don't restart yet. Dump lsof output, diff against the baseline snapshot, and flag any sockets stuck in CLOSE_WAIT. Usual suspect: the Pellman cache client. Full triage steps and the baseline snapshot live on the internal page below.

runbook for badug-kadup: https://confluence.zemvarlabs.internal/projects/browse/display/projects/bd1b